fluvoxaMINE tofacitinib

Applies to: fluvoxamine and tofacitinib

ADJUST DOSE: Coadministration with one or more medications that may result in both moderate inhibition of CYP450 3A4 and potent inhibition of CYP450 2C19 may significantly increase the plasma concentrations of tofacitinib, which is primarily metabolized by the former isoenzyme with minor contribution from the latter. In study subjects, administration with the moderate CYP450 3A4 and potent CYP450 2C19 inhibitor fluconazole increased tofacitinib peak plasma concentration (Cmax) and systemic exposure (AUC) by approximately 27% and 79%, respectively, compared to administration of tofacitinib alone. Side effects including lymphopenia, neutropenia, anemia, serious infections, and hyperlipidemia may be increased.

MANAGEMENT: The dosage of tofacitinib should be reduced by 50% when used concomitantly with one or more medications that may result in both moderate inhibition of CYP450 3A4 and potent inhibition of CYP450 2C19. For example, the dose for patients receiving 10 mg twice daily should be reduced to 5 mg twice daily and the dose for patients receiving 5 mg twice daily should be reduced to 5 mg once daily. For patients receiving 11 mg once daily of the extended-release formulation, the dose should be reduced to 5 mg once daily of the immediate-release formulation. The dose for patients receiving 3.2 mg twice daily should be reduced to 3.2 mg once daily and the dose for patients receiving 4 mg twice daily should be reduced to 4 mg once daily. Moderate inhibitors of CYP450 3A4 include amiodarone, aprepitant, ciprofloxacin, crizotinib, darunavir, dalfopristin-quinupristin, diltiazem, dronedarone, erythromycin, fluconazole, fusidic acid, grapefruit juice, imatinib, isavuconazonium, netupitant, and verapamil. Potent inhibitors of CYP450 2C19 include fluconazole, fluvoxamine, esomeprazole, lansoprazole, and omeprazole. Inhibitors of CYP450 2C19 alone are unlikely to substantially alter the pharmacokinetics of tofacitinib.

fluvoxaMINE food

Applies to: fluvoxamine

GENERALLY AVOID: Alcohol may potentiate some of the pharmacologic effects of CNS-active agents. Use in combination may result in additive central nervous system depression and/or impairment of judgment, thinking, and psychomotor skills.

MANAGEMENT: Patients receiving CNS-active agents should be warned of this interaction and advised to avoid or limit consumption of alcohol. Ambulatory patients should be counseled to avoid hazardous activities requiring complete mental alertness and motor coordination until they know how these agents affect them, and to notify their physician if they experience excessive or prolonged CNS effects that interfere with their normal activities.

tofacitinib food

Applies to: tofacitinib

MONITOR: Grapefruit juice may increase the plasma concentrations of tofacitinib. The proposed mechanism is inhibition of CYP450 3A4-mediated first-pass metabolism in the gut wall by certain compounds present in grapefruits. The extent and clinical significance are unknown. Moreover, pharmacokinetic alterations associated with interactions involving grapefruit juice are often subject to a high degree of interpatient variability.

MANAGEMENT: Until more information is available, some authorities recommend avoiding consumption of grapefruit juice during tofacitinib therapy (Canada). Patients receiving tofacitinib therapy who ingest grapefruits or grapefruit juice should be monitored for adverse effects and undue fluctuations in plasma drug levels.

Drug Interaction Classification

These classifications are only a guideline. The relevance of a particular drug interaction to a specific individual is difficult to determine. Always consult your healthcare provider before starting or stopping any medication.
Major Highly clinically significant. Avoid combinations; the risk of the interaction outweighs the benefit.
Moderate Moderately clinically significant. Usually avoid combinations; use it only under special circumstances.
Minor Minimally clinically significant. Minimize risk; assess risk and consider an alternative drug, take steps to circumvent the interaction risk and/or institute a monitoring plan.
Unknown No interaction information available.
